Frances Jennings Casement was an American suffragette and voting advocate from Painesville, Ohio. Her father Charles C. Jennings was a politician active in the abolition movement in the 1830s. Frances married General John S. Casement in 1857. He was elected as representative to congress and lobbied for voting rights for women.Return to Ohio Biographies Return to Index. John S. Casement (1829-1909) was born in New York and came to Ohio in 1850 to work as a railroad construction foreman. After service in the Civil War, Casement obtained a contract to perform tracklaying and grading for the Union Pacific's transcontinental line.On 21 May 1944 (around 1945B/21), the following ships were detached to Oran; Andrew Furuseth, Caleb Strong, Calvin Coolidge, Edward H. USS Guardian (YAGR-1) was a Guardian-class radar picket ship acquired by the U.S. Navy during World War II. Her task was to act as part of the radar defenses of the United States after the close of World War II. Guardian was launched as Liberty Ship SS James G. Squires 8 May 1945 by J. A.
